  • the present invention relates to a device and a corresponding method for authorizing a user to get access to content stored in encrypted form on a storage medium, said storage medium storing a machine-readable medium identifier and at least one key table encrypted by use of a key table key and storing at least one asset key for decrypting encrypted content.
  • the invention relates further to a network in which said method is employed as well as to a computer program for implementing said method.
  • European patent appl ication 02 078 437.7 (PI INL020775) describes a method of protecting content stored on a storage medium against unauthorized access, said storage medium being accessible by a drive of a portable device which is conncctable to a network.
  • the authentication procedure of the network is used to generate a cryptographic key, hereinafter called asset key. for encryption and decryption of content stored on said storage medium.
  • asset key a cryptographic key
  • the storage medium contains a unique medium identifier and that the mobile communication network authentication procedure is used to transform this medium identifier into the actual asset key.
  • SIM encryption method This transform is performed by the user's SIM card, when used in a mobile phone network, so that without this SIM card the content of the storage medium can not be read.
  • This provides a very simple and secure way for users to protect their private content, also referred to as SIM encryption method in the following.
  • a drawback of this approach is that access to the content is restricted to a single user, or more particularly, to a single user's SIM card. It is thus an object of the present invention to provide a device and method which allow the user to provide access to the content to other users in a simple, but still secure way. Further, transparent access from different devices owned by the same user, for instance from different mobile phones having different SIM cards, shall be enabled. A corresponding network and a computer program for implementing said method shall be provided as well.

  • the present invention is based on the idea to use the authentication process of a network for enabling a user who has access to content stored on a storage medium to authorize other users to get access to the same content.
  • the authentication unit of the network By use of the medium identifier and the user identifier of a user who shall be authorized the authentication unit of the network generates and provides a key table key.
  • This key table key can then be used by the user lo be authorized to decrypt an assigned and predetermined key table provided for this "new " user in which key table an asset key is stored for decryption of thc content to which he shall get access.
  • "new " risers can be added to an authorization list without their direct involvement.
  • the network proposed according to the present invention which is preferably a communication network such as a GSM or an UMTS network, comprises at least two user devices, which may both belong to the same user or to different users, and an authentication unit for authenticating users when they connect to the network.
  • the authentication procedure used for authenticating users is very secure since breaking the authentication algorithm used in a mobile communication network would allow the user to make calls that would be billed to other users.
  • the level of protection of such an authentication algorithm is very high and is considered to be sufficient for protecting the user's data when using the authentication algorithm for generating key table keys as proposed according to the present invention.
  • said authentication unit is also used for generating asset keys as described in the above mentioned European patent application 02 078 437.7 (PHNL020775). The description of this method in this document is herein incorporated by reference. Preferred embodiments of the invention are defined in dependent claims.
  • the device further comprises a receiver for receiving the key table key for the user to be authorized from the network, and the transmitter is operative for transmitting the received key table key to said user.
  • the user who wants to authorize another user to have access to content communicates with the network to get a new key table key for the other user which is then received by him and forwarded to the other user, for instance in the form of an SMS or any other electronic message.
  • the user to be authorized is thus not involved in the procedure of generating the new key table key.
  • the new key table key may also be provided directly from the network to the user to be authorized.
  • the network can use the user identifier already provided by the first user together with a medium identifier to the authentication unit for generation of the key table key.
  • the storage medium not only stores one single key table but a plurality of key tables, for instance one key table for each user.

  • Fig. 1 shows a storage medium 10 according to the present invention and illustrates what is stored on such a record carrier.
  • a particular user of a first user device has access to content which is stored in encrypted form on a record carrier 10, for instance an optical record carrier such as a CD, DVD or BD, which is readable by the user device, which may, for instance, be a portable mobile phone having a drive for accessing the record carrier 10.
  • the record carrier 10 - besides the encrypted content - stores a machine-readable medium identifier id and at least one key table KL, which is encrypted by use of a key table key KLK and which stores at least one asset key AK.
  • Said asset key AK has been used for encrypting the content C and thus needs to be used by a user for decrypting the encrypted content C.
  • each key table KL might store more than one asset key AK for decrypting different portions of content C stored on the record carrier 10.
  • each key table there might be a user check identifier UC assigned for finding the right key table KL and/or each key table might comprise a decryption check identifier DC for seeing if a key table KL has been correctly decrypted, which will be both explained below in more detail.

  • the mobile phones 1 , 2 each comprise a SIM card reader 4 for reading a SIM card 20.
  • an authentication key is stored which is a secret key shared with an authentication center AuC of the GSM network 3 used for authentication of the mobile phones 1 , 2 when connecting to the network 3.
  • the mobile phones 1 , 2 further comprise a drive 5 for reading data from and/or storing data on a removable storage medium 10, which can, for instance, be a small form factor optical disc drive.
  • the user devices I . 2 further comprise connection means 6 for connecting to the network 3 including a transmitter 7 for transmitting data and a receiver 8 for receiving data.
  • the mobi le communication netw oi k authentication procedure is used to transform the unique identifier of the record carrier 10 (e.g. a serial number stored in a particular area on the record carrier 10) into the asset key AK used for encryption of thc content C (or part of the content) stored on (he record carrier 10.
  • This transform is cither performed by the SIM card 20 or by the authentication center AuC, so that without this SIM card the content can not be decrypted and read.
  • This provides a very simple and secure way for the user to protect his private content. If the user now desires to allow other users to access his content or to enable transparent access from different devices owned by himself, the following procedure is performed.
  • the unique identifier id is read from the record carrier.
  • This medium identifier id and a user identifier ui of a second user who shall be authorized by the first user to get access to a particular piece of the first user's content, are then (S2) transmitted to the authentication center AuC of the network 3.
  • a key table key KLK for instance a key locker key in case the key tables are in the form of key lockers, is generated by the key generator 31 from the medium identifier id and the user identifier ui.
  • the generated key table key KLK can then be transmitted back only to the first user device 1 (S4) or both to the first user device 1 and to the second user device 2 (S8).
  • the first user device 1 generates now a key table KL2 for the second user 2 (S5) by use of the received key table key KLK, i.e. the asset key(s) which shall be given to the second user for accessing content are encrypted by said key table key KLK.
  • the second user 2 is then authorized by getting the key table key KLK for decrypting the newly generated key table KL2 from the first user (S6).
  • the key table key KLK By use of the key table key KLK he is then able to decrypt the key table KL2, read the asset key(s) from it and use the asset key(s) for decryption of content.
  • the user 2 is thus added to the authorization list without direct involvement.

  • the key tables may include some randomly generated padding fields to make hacking more difficult.
  • the key tables are key lockers so that different rights can be stored for each user and some content is hidden from some users.
  • the key tables may also be all (for each user) located inside a key locker.
  • the key locker key is then a hidden key on the record carrier.
  • the user devices may include a user check unit 1 1 to check a corresponding user check identifier uc preferably stored on the record carrier and assigned to each key table. This user check identifier uc is used to find the correct key table for a user so that decryption of each available key table in order to find the correct one can be avoided.
  • the user's SIM card contains an identifier to identify the user to the mobile network, called international mobile subscriber identity (IMSI) in GSM, which can used.
  • IMSI international mobile subscriber identity
  • GSM Global System for Mobile communications
  • the user's phone number can be used.
  • this user check identifier uc could be encrypted in a very simple way, e.g. XOR with a key. This means, that again each user check identifier needs to be decrypted by means of a relatively simple XOR operation. Since each user check identifier is preferably XORed with a different key, there is no easy way to determine the underlying user check identifier so that this method may hide the user's identity with sufficient security.
  • a user who wants to authorize other users also generates a new key table for each new user. Therefore, a key table generating unit 12 is also provided in each user device I as also shown in Fig. 4.
  • the user who creates the content will be authorized as indicated in the above mentioned European patent application 02 078 437.7 (PHNL 020775). Adding further users to the authorization list can be done through the network. Therefore, a secure connection is preferably provided between the user device and the network (in particularly the home location register HLR) in GSM of the user to be authorized.
